Title :
Soft X-Ray CT Imaging of a Low-Aspect-Ratio Toroidal Plasma Maintained Solely by Electron Cyclotron Heating

Abstract :
Images of soft X-ray (SX) emission in a poloidal cross section have been reconstructed by computer tomography from 80 chord-integrated signals in total obtained in a low-aspect-ratio toroidal plasma produced and maintained solely by electron cyclotron (EC) heating on the LATE device. The SX images show the heating characteristics by electron Bernstein waves under the existence of multiharmonics of EC resonance in the low-aspect-ratio toroidal plasma.
